Abstract

Sound preservation practice is a series of active engagements with the content one hopes to preserve. In many cases, this has not always been the case. Both institutions and services—while not actively encouraging passive preservation—neglect the key components in the stewardship of our historical record. In other words, there is much more to preservation than simply choosing a storage solution and placing one’s content there. The materials need to be verified, checked, and tested against expectations within the service. This is accepted practice for many. However, very few services provide the necessary assurance to test both its own user expectations as well as the depositors’ themselves. Creating a methodology for both depositor and service to be assured that preservation meets expectations is critical. This is happening in very select ways. This paper discusses one such dialogue and its function.
